A man charged with the murder of his mother has had his case adjourned today after a brief appearance in the New Plymouth High Court.
Justice Paul Heath ordered that the grounds for the adjournment be suppressed.
David Blake (47) will now reappear on April 20 for a case review hearing.
He is charged with the murder of his mother, Stratford woman Gwen Blake (71), on January 30. Police were called to a Regan Street address after a member of the public reported hearing shouting at the house. An autopsy found that she died as a result of injuries related to a serious assault. No further details about the type of assault have been released.
